cyprus-mail49d ago

Khamenei’s son Mojtaba is alive and favoured to succeed him, Iranian sources say

Mojtaba Khamenei, the powerful son of Iran’s slain Supreme Leader Ali Khamenei, is alive and favoured to emerge as his father’s successor, two Iranian sources told Reuters on Wednesday. Even as new explosions rang out in Tehran, huge crowds of mourners were expected in the streets later on Wednesday to grieve the elder Khamenei, 86, […]

RapplerMostly Factual49d ago

Khamenei’s son Mojtaba is alive and favored to succeed him, Iranian sources say

Iran says the Assembly of Experts, which will select the new leader, will announce its decision soon, only the second time it has done so since the Islamic Republic's founding in 1979.
